Kevin Durant joined the Golden State Warriors for a real shot at winning an NBA championship. His clutch bucket in Game 3 of the NBA Finals on Wednesday night now puts him one win away from doing just that.
With the Warriors trailing the Cleveland Cavaliers 113-111 with under a minute remaining, Durant sunk a pull-up 3-pointer to give Golden State a one-point advantage.

The Dubs wouldn’t look back, and held on for an impressive 118-113 victory at Quicken Loans Arena.
Durant has been incredible throughout the series, and now he’s just one strong performance away from winning his first NBA title.
